Leon VILLAR - Spain - Judo (Profile on BEST sports Database)
Medals
Gold
Silver
Bronze
Country
ESP - Spain (1993-1993)
Sport
- Judo
Distribution of Results
Performance
World Championships
19536 / 35236
Total
520 / 960
Spain
666 / 1044
Judo
19536 / 35236
Total
520 / 960
Spain
666 / 1044
Judo